DASCHUND BEHAVIOUR PROBLEMS
Dear Bernice,
We adopted our neighbours Daschund crossing in December last year. Her name is Roxy and she is really adorable. The problem that we have is that she does not get along with our housekeeper. She barks and charges at her. She eventually calms down a bit while the housekeeper is in the house but as soon as the housekeeper leaves the house and comes back inside it starts all over again. I am not sure if it is fear or aggression or a combination of both. She does not bite her.
We took her to the Vet to get her injections up to date. According to the Vet se is +/- 4 years old. She is sterilised.
We contacted a Behaviour specialist in February this year who gave us a few pointers with no success. She then suggested medication.
Roxy is now on the medication for nearly five weeks but I do not really see any difference yet. It is an anti-depressant.
Her behaviour is a big problem for us because we cannot leave her to go out. We want to get het a companion but I am wondering if she will teach her behaviour problems to the new puppy?
Do you think a site visit will be best?
